A ramp meter will be installed on a freeway on-ramp (length of ramp is 1000 ft). The metering will start operating at 7:00 AM. The transportation engineer responsible for the ramp metering installation proposed to allow one vehicle every 8 seconds for the period 7:00 – 7:30 AM, one vehicle every 7.5 seconds for 7:30 – 8:30 AM and one vehicle every 4 seconds after 8:30 AM. The transportation engineer also collected data at the ramp and found that the arrival rate is 500 veh/h (constant) throughout the day.
Assuming a D/D/1 queueing system, draw the queueing diagram and compute:
1. the time when the queue dissipates,
2. the longest queue,
3. the longest delay, and
4. the total vehicle delay.
5. Will the queue be long enough to interfere with the arterial street traffic? Assume that the average length of a vehicle in queue is 25 ft (including gap with front vehicle)
